1. The Full Name: Central Processing Unit (CPU) 🤯
Ever wondered what CPU stands for? It’s the Central Processing Unit. Think of it as the brain of your computer, where all the thinking happens. Just like your brain processes information, the CPU handles all the calculations and instructions that make your computer run smoothly. 🧠💻
Fun fact: The first CPU, the Intel 4004, was introduced in 1971 and had only 2,300 transistors. Today’s CPUs can have billions! 🚀
2. How Does the CPU Work? 🛠️
The CPU is like a super-efficient traffic director, managing all the data flowing through your computer. Here’s a quick breakdown:
- **Fetching**: The CPU retrieves instructions from memory.
- **Decoding**: It translates those instructions into actions.
- **Executing**: The CPU performs the actions, whether it’s opening an app or rendering a video.
- **Storing**: Results are stored back in memory for future use.
Imagine it as a high-speed assembly line, where each step is crucial for the final product. 🏗️
3. Types of CPUs: From Desktops to Smartphones 📱
Not all CPUs are created equal. Here are a few types you might encounter:
- **Desktop CPUs**: Powerful and designed for heavy tasks like gaming and video editing. Think Intel Core i9 or AMD Ryzen 9.
- **Laptop CPUs**: More energy-efficient and compact, perfect for on-the-go computing. Examples include Intel Core i7 and AMD Ryzen 7.
- **Mobile CPUs**: Found in smartphones and tablets, these are optimized for battery life and portability. Apple’s A-series chips and Qualcomm’s Snapdragon are top players here.
Each type has its strengths, making them suitable for different devices and tasks. 📊
4. The Future of CPUs: Quantum Computing and Beyond 🌌
As technology advances, so does the CPU. We’re already seeing improvements like multi-core processors and integrated GPUs. But the future is even more exciting:
- **Quantum Computing**: Imagine a CPU that can process multiple states simultaneously, solving problems that are currently unsolvable. Companies like IBM and Google are leading the charge.
- **Neuromorphic Computing**: Inspired by the human brain, these CPUs aim to mimic neural networks for more efficient and powerful computing.
While we’re not there yet, the potential is mind-blowing. 🤯
